Gateway padrão no CentOS

Encaminhamento

No CentOS, você pode verificar a tabela de roteamento com:

$ route -n

O comando anterior imprime uma tabela como esta:

Kernel IP routing table
Destination Gateway Genmask Flags Metric Ref Use Iface
10.254.1.0 0.0.0.0 255.255.255.0 U 0 0 0 eth0
192.168.185.0 0.0.0.0 255.255.255.0 U 0 0 0 eth1
0.0.0.0 192.168.185.2 0.0.0.0 UG 0 0 0 eth1

A última linha da tabela indica o gateway padrão da máquina. Nesse caso:

0.0.0.0         192.168.185.2  0.0.0.0         UG    0      0        0 eth1

Alterar gateway padrão

Você pode controlar o gateway padrão usando o comando de rota:

$ route del default gw <default_gateway_ip>
$ route
add default gw <default_gateway_ip>

Lembre-se de que essas alterações são apenas temporárias. Para alterar o gateway padrão permanentemente, você precisa editar o arquivo / etc / sysconfig / network e mudar para:

GATEWAY=<new_default_gateway_ip>

Com várias interfaces na mesma sub-rede, também é possível designar a rota preferida para o gateway padrão com:

GATEWAYDEV=<network_interface>